Pengrowth has targeted East Bodo (Alberta side) and Cosine (Saskatchewan side) for waterflood optimization and subsequent enhanced oil recovery applications. Currently, the most practical EOR technology for this heavy oil reservoir seems to be the polymer flood technology in combination with horizontal wells. Fluorosurfactants are effective in a variety of Enhanced Oil Recovery (EOR) techniques including (i) improving subterranean wetting, (ii) increasing foam stability, and (iii) modifying the surface properties of the reservoir formation. CO2-based enhanced gas recovery (EGR) is an appealing method with the dual benefit of improving from mature reservoirs and storing CO2 in subsurface, thereby reducing net emissions. However, injection for EGR has drawback excessive mixing methane gas, therefore, quality produced leading to early breakthrough CO2.
